黑狐家游戏

负载均衡的方式有几种,负载均衡的几种方式是指什么

欧气 2 0

负载均衡的几种方式及其应用

一、引言

在当今数字化时代,随着业务的不断增长和用户需求的增加,服务器面临着巨大的压力,为了确保系统的高可用性和性能,负载均衡技术应运而生,负载均衡是一种将网络流量分配到多个服务器上的技术,它可以有效地提高系统的性能、可靠性和可扩展性,本文将介绍负载均衡的几种方式及其应用。

二、负载均衡的方式

1、软件负载均衡:软件负载均衡是通过在服务器上安装负载均衡软件来实现的,常见的软件负载均衡有 LVS(Linux Virtual Server)、HAProxy 等,软件负载均衡的优点是成本低、配置灵活,可以根据实际需求进行定制,缺点是性能相对较低,对服务器的性能有一定的影响。

2、硬件负载均衡:硬件负载均衡是通过专门的硬件设备来实现的,常见的硬件负载均衡有 F5 BIG-IP、A10 Networks 等,硬件负载均衡的优点是性能高、可靠性强,可以处理大量的并发请求,缺点是成本高,配置相对复杂。

3、DNS 负载均衡:DNS 负载均衡是通过修改 DNS 服务器的解析记录来实现的,当用户访问域名时,DNS 服务器会根据负载均衡算法将请求分配到不同的服务器上,DNS 负载均衡的优点是简单、成本低,不需要额外的硬件设备,缺点是无法根据服务器的实时负载情况进行动态分配,可能导致部分服务器负载过高,而部分服务器负载过低。

4、七层负载均衡:七层负载均衡是通过分析 HTTP 请求的内容来实现的,七层负载均衡可以根据请求的 URL、参数、cookie 等信息进行智能分配,提高系统的性能和用户体验,七层负载均衡的优点是智能、高效,可以根据实际需求进行定制,缺点是配置相对复杂,对服务器的性能有一定的影响。

三、负载均衡的应用场景

1、网站访问:当网站的访问量较大时,可以通过负载均衡技术将请求分配到多个服务器上,提高网站的性能和可靠性。

2、数据库访问:当数据库的访问量较大时,可以通过负载均衡技术将请求分配到多个数据库服务器上,提高数据库的性能和可靠性。

3、应用服务器访问:当应用服务器的访问量较大时,可以通过负载均衡技术将请求分配到多个应用服务器上,提高应用服务器的性能和可靠性。

4、云计算环境:在云计算环境中,负载均衡技术可以将用户的请求分配到不同的云服务器上,提高系统的性能和可靠性。

四、负载均衡的注意事项

1、负载均衡算法的选择:不同的负载均衡算法适用于不同的场景,需要根据实际需求进行选择。

2、服务器的健康检查:需要定期对服务器进行健康检查,确保服务器的正常运行。

3、数据的一致性:在进行负载均衡时,需要注意数据的一致性,避免出现数据丢失或不一致的情况。

4、安全问题:负载均衡设备需要进行安全防护,避免受到黑客攻击。

五、结论

负载均衡是一种非常重要的技术,它可以有效地提高系统的性能、可靠性和可扩展性,在实际应用中,需要根据实际需求选择合适的负载均衡方式,并注意负载均衡的注意事项,以确保系统的正常运行。

标签: #负载均衡 #方式 #几种 #含义

黑狐家游戏
  • 评论列表

留言评论